Exactly what is Reddit and r/WallStreetBets?
Reddit is often a social websites platform where by people can generate “subreddits†based on interests or matters, like finance and investing. Among the most nicely-known subreddits relevant to stock trading is r/WallStreetBets (WSB), a Local community focused on high-possibility, substantial-reward stock investing and selections trading. Customers on this forum generally share their investment decision strategies, inventory picks, and trading Suggestions, in some cases in the humorous and irreverent way.
The r/WallStreetBets community attained mainstream consideration in 2021, when a group of retail traders on Reddit collectively drove up the stock price ranges of sure businesses, which include GameStop (GME), AMC Enjoyment (AMC), and BlackBerry (BB), as a result of coordinated acquiring efforts.
How Reddit Influences the Inventory Market
Limited Squeeze Occasions Just about the most noteworthy examples of Reddit’s affect on the inventory market would be the GameStop short squeeze that came about in early 2021. A brief squeeze takes place when traders who've bet against a stock (limited sellers) are pressured to acquire back again the inventory to address their positions, driving the stock value higher.
GameStop Scenario: Customers with the r/WallStreetBets subreddit noticed that GameStop had an unusually superior quantity of limited positions, meaning institutional investors have been betting that the corporation’s stock value would drop. Redditors made a decision to purchase the stock, triggering the worth to skyrocket from about $20 in early January to nearly $483 by the end of the month.
Influence on Hedge Resources: The fast rise in GameStop’s inventory price tag led to large losses for hedge funds and quick sellers, with a few firms being forced to close their positions at a reduction. This party demonstrated the strength of retail buyers to affect stock costs and challenged classic market dynamics.
Meme Shares Reddit’s impression has offered rise towards the phenomenon of “meme shares†— stocks that achieve reputation and substantial price movements mainly on account of social media marketing Excitement, rather than the company’s basic worth. Well-known meme shares incorporate:
GameStop (GME)
AMC Amusement (AMC)
BlackBerry (BB)
Mattress Bathtub & Past (BBBY)
These stocks generally working experience immediate price movements, pushed by exhilaration and hoopla generated on platforms like Reddit, as an alternative to regular components like earnings experiences or marketplace information.
FOMO and Herd Mentality An important element of Reddit’s stock sector affect would be the Dread of Missing Out (FOMO) mentality. As stocks obtain focus on Reddit, Specifically on discussion boards like r/WallStreetBets, it produces a sense of urgency for investors to leap in, fearing they may skip a worthwhile opportunity.
Herd mentality: Reddit communities can rally close to selected shares, pushing selling prices better because of collective obtaining. Because the stock cost rises, more people Take part, plus the momentum builds. This may result in Excessive volatility, the place rates surge without having regard to an organization’s actual fundamentals.
Pump-and-dump techniques: Occasionally, these coordinated endeavours can resemble pump-and-dump strategies, the place a stock’s cost is artificially inflated by way of buzz, only to crash after the “pumps†(investors) promote off their positions.

Pitfalls of Reddit-Driven Stock Movements
Even though Reddit can provide prospects for retail investors to cash in on fast selling price swings, it’s necessary to admit the dangers included:
Volatility: Shares pushed by Reddit hoopla can encounter Intense volatility, producing them unpredictable and risky. Buyers could possibly be left with significant losses if the inventory value crashes once the hype dies down.
Unpredictable Market place Conduct: The influence of Reddit traders is usually not according to the basics of a business. As a result, stock price ranges may not mirror the particular well being of the business, bringing about artificially inflated valuations which are at risk of unexpected corrections.
Regulatory Scrutiny: The rise of Reddit-driven inventory actions has caught the eye of regulators and lawmakers. Fears about industry manipulation, insider investing, and also the ethics of online community forums pushing inventory price ranges bigger have brought about calls for a lot more oversight. If the SEC (Securities and Trade Commission) ended up to phase in, it could influence the power of Reddit communities to impact inventory rates.
